For future maintainers: DocSentry 3.2 incorrectly flags admonition blocks nested inside tables as "orphaned callouts," even when they are properly closed. Root cause appears to be the tokenizer resetting depth counters at each table cell boundary. The fix adjusts depth tracking to be cell-scoped and adds regression fixtures under `fixtures/nested-admonitions/`. Please verify the fixtures pass locally before approving, since CI skips the slow lint suite on draft branches. The verifying build token appears below.

build token for kagaf-hahof: htk14_9d3d4d26d7d8de

## Authentication

Since the v3.1 fix for the GraphQL N+1 query issue in Orderlens, batched resolvers require an authenticated session against the internal Loaderhub service. Support staff reproducing slow-query tickets should hit the staging endpoint directly. All requests must include the service key in the request header. The current key is provided below.

service key, fawip-bajef: kto11_Qt5wZK9vdNC

### Changelog — 2.9.1 (key rotation)

Rotated the release signing key for the Mercanto catalog cache-invalidation service. Old key revoked effective this build; artifacts signed with it will fail verification after the grace window. Invalidation fanout logic unchanged. Mirrors and CI verifiers must update their trust config before pulling 2.9.1 or later. No action needed for runtime nodes. All subsequent releases are signed with the new key, listed here:

rollout seal: bky4_DFM9

Subject: On-call handover — orders soft deletes

Hi Marek,

Quick note before you take over. We shipped the soft-delete change to the Cartwheel orders table last night: rows now get a deleted_at timestamp instead of being removed. Plugin authors querying orders directly must filter on deleted_at IS NULL, or they'll see ghost orders. The compat view orders_active handles this automatically. Docs are updated in the Cartwheel developer portal. If plugin authors hit anything weird, route them to the integrations inbox.

escalation mailbox, tafop-fahif: oliael@tolvaqlabs.corp